IIRC, when Jackee was on AW, the writers tailored comedic storylines for Lily (and for Cass, Cecile, Felicia and Wallingford) that played to Jackee's strengths. Same goes for when Dorothy Lyman played Opal on AMC, or even when Sheri Anderson, Leah Laiman and Thom Racina wrote for Arleen Sorkin/Calliope. Writing for Jackee the same kinds of stories that DAYS writes for everyone else just plain doesn't work.
